Oracle Health (formerly Cerner) integration spans several surfaces: FHIR R4 for modern resource access, the Millennium APIs for platform-native data and workflow, SMART on FHIR for apps that launch inside PowerChart, and HL7 v2 for legacy ADT, ORU, and ORM feeds. Onboarding runs through the code (code.cerner.com) developer console and program.
As with any large EHR, the engineering is bounded and the access is not. Code console registration, sandbox provisioning, scope approval, and client-side enablement sit on the vendor's and your customer's timelines. We scope those dependencies first so the integration doesn't stall after the interfaces are written.

Common failure modes
Challenge
Code console onboarding stalls the project
Agnotic approach
We start code console registration and sandbox access in week one and run mapping in parallel while credentials land.
Challenge
FHIR coverage varies by Millennium version
Agnotic approach
Per-site capability assessment identifies what FHIR R4 supports and where Millennium APIs or HL7 v2 fill gaps.
Challenge
OAuth2 scopes fail review
Agnotic approach
We map each call to a least-privilege scope so approval is clean the first time.
Challenge
Sandbox behavior differs from production
Agnotic approach
Partner-assisted validation and reconciliation workflows catch production drift before go-live.
The exact surface, named up front — because it determines what's buildable and by when.
Platform-native access to Oracle Health's Millennium data and workflow — the surface for capabilities that reach beyond the standardized FHIR resource set.
Read and write against Oracle Health's FHIR R4 API — Patient, Encounter, Observation, MedicationRequest, and more, with strong coverage in modern Millennium versions.
Registration and sandbox provisioning through the code (code.cerner.com) developer console — client credentials, app registration, and the path to production.
EHR and standalone SMART on FHIR launch with scoped OAuth2 for apps that run inside PowerChart, including launch context and token handling.
ADT, ORU, and ORM message feeds via an interface engine for legacy event flows where FHIR coverage doesn't reach.
Interface health dashboards, failed-message alerting, and reconciliation so a dropped feed or throttled call is caught before it becomes a clinical gap.

Surface & timeline
Different needs use different Oracle Health channels. Here's how we choose.
| Surface | Method | Typical timeline | Notes |
|---|---|---|---|
| FHIR R4 API | RESTful resource read/write | 2–4 months | Strong coverage in modern Millennium versions; onboard via code console. |
| Millennium APIs | Platform-native access | 3–5 months | For workflow and data beyond the standard FHIR set. |
| SMART on FHIR | OAuth2 launch + scopes | 3–5 months | Scope approval and review drive the timeline. |
| HL7 v2 interfaces | ADT / ORU / ORM feeds | 3–5 months | Per-site interface build for legacy event flows. |
Timelines assume code console access and an engaged customer-side Oracle Health team. Access and review, not engineering, set the pace.
